Manufacturing Engineer
Manufacturing Engineer
Position OverviewWe are seeking a skilled Manufacturing Engineer to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for optimizing manufacturing processes, ensuring production efficiency, and contributing to continuous improvement initiatives. This role requires a strong background in process manufacturing and tool design, as well as hands-on experience in a production environment. Key Responsibilities
- Design and improve manufacturing processes to enhance productivity and reduce costs.
- Develop and implement process improvements using Lean Manufacturing principles.
- Create and review tool designs to support efficient production operations.
- Troubleshoot and resolve manufacturing issues related to equipment and processes.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ure alignment on production goals and standards.
- Analyze production data to identify trends and opportunities for non-conformance resolution.
- Manage projects related to manufacturing process development and efficiency improvements.
- Conduct training for production staff on new processes and technologies.
- Utilize 3D Solid Modeling software, such as Solid Works, for design and simulation purposes.
- Document processes and maintain records in compliance with quality standards.
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Manufacturing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, or a related field.
- Minimum of 2 years of experience in a manufacturing environment.
- Strong knowledge of process manufacturing and tool design principles.
- Experience with pneumatics and hydraulics systems.
- Familiarity with Lean Manufacturing techniques and principles.
- Proven track record in manufacturing process development and production efficiency.
- Excellent problem-solving skills and troubleshooting ability.
- Strong project management skills and experience leading projects in a manufacturing setting.
- Proficient in MS Office applications and 3D Solid Modeling software.
- Good communication skills and ability to work collaboratively in a team.
